==History==
Born Mary Sandra Campbell, on December 5, 1954 to [[Samuel]] and [[Deanna Campbell]]. She has at least one unnamed uncle, who [[Sam]] and [[Dean]] have never met.<ref>[[2.04 Children Shouldn't Play with Dead Things]]</ref> She kept extensive journals.<ref>[[The Journal (diary entries)]]</ref>. Mary traveled around with her family, learning the hunting trade until they you ended up in Lawrence, Kansas. On March 23, 1972 after seeing the film ''Slaughterhouse-Five'', Mary bumped into [[John Winchester]], knocking him down. While Mary was embarrassed, John simply laughed it off, and told her she could get him a cup coffee to make it up to him. The two would go to Maroni's Diner and talk. And when John asked for Mary's number, she gave it to him, despite knowing her father wouldn't approve. In 1973, after [[Azazel]] killed John, Mary made a deal with in order to resurrect him. This involved her granting him access to her home ten years hence. On August 19, 1975 Mary and John eloped, in Reno. Five years later Mary would give birth to [[Dean]] on January 4, 1979, with Sam following on May 2, 1983.Dean remembers her making tomato and rice soup for him when he was sick, and singing "Hey, Jude" to him as a lullaby.<ref>[[5.13 The Song Remains the Same]]</ref> Despite how John talked about Mary to Sam and Dean, there were indications that there marriage was not entirely happy<ref>[[5.16 Dark Side of the Moon]]</ref>, and that [[Heaven]] may have been involved in bringing them together, in order for Dean and Sam to be born.<ref>[[5.14 My Bloody Valentine]]</ref>
Six months after Sam's birth, [[Azazel ]] visit Sam to feed him [[Demon Blooddemon blood]]. When Mary tries to stop him, he kills her. She was 29. An unknown uncle a headstone erected a headstone for her in Greenville, Illinois. After the death of John, Sam and Dean would bury his dogtags at Mary's grave. 33 years later, as he was about to face [[Amara]], Dean said told Sam that he wanted his ashes scattered thereat Mary's grave. <ref>[[11.23 Alpha and Omega]]</ref>.
